```mediawiki = Ponzi Schemes: A Beginner's Guide =

A Ponzi scheme is a fraudulent investment scam that promises high returns with little to no risk. Named after Charles Ponzi, who became infamous for using this technique in the early 20th century, these schemes rely on paying earlier investors with funds collected from newer investors, rather than from actual profit earned.
